| /** |
| * WebDAV dead properties storage using a DataSource. |
| * <p> |
| * A single properties table with four columns is used: |
| * <ul> |
| * <li>path: the resource path</li> |
| * <li>namespace: the node namespace</li> |
| * <li>name: the local name in the namespace</li> |
| * <li>node: the full serialized XML node including the name</li> |
| * </ul> |
| * The table name used can be configured using the <code>tableName</code> property of the store. |
| * <p> |
| * Example table schema: <code>CREATE TABLE properties ( |
| * path VARCHAR(1024) NOT NULL, |
| * namespace VARCHAR(64) NOT NULL, |
| * name VARCHAR(64) NOT NULL, |
| * node VARCHAR(2048) NOT NULL, |
| * PRIMARY KEY (path, namespace, name) |
| * )</code> |
| */ |
